The conflict between Israel and Egypt over the Sinai Peninsula is an
example of boundary exchange through territoriality. The Sinai peninsula
has been part of Egypt from the First Dynasty of ancient Egypt. Israel
invaded and occupied Sinai during the Suez Crisis of 1956, and during
the Six-Day war of 1967.

Psycholinguistics: The term psycholinguistics was first introduced by one of the famous psychologist named Wilhelm Wundt in Leipzig, Germany during 1879.
Psycholinguistics is also referred to as the psychology of language and is defined as the study of the neurobiological and psychological perspectives that helps human beings to gain, understand, and use language. It is considered as the study of the production of language and comprehension in written, spoken and signed forms.
Branches of psycholinguistics:
1. Language Acquisition.
2. Language Comprehension.
3. Language Production.
